What were the price fluctuations of bitcoin in the past 5 years?
Can you provide an overview of the price fluctuations of bitcoin over the past 5 years? How has the price changed and what were the major factors influencing these fluctuations?

- Upgrade DigitallyFeb 02, 2022 · 4 years agoAs an expert in the field, I can tell you that the price fluctuations of bitcoin in the past 5 years have been quite remarkable. From a low of around $430 in 2016, it reached an all-time high of nearly $20,000 in December 2017. However, it then experienced a significant correction and dropped to around $3,000 by December 2018. Since then, it has been gradually climbing back up, but still hasn't reached its previous peak. These price fluctuations are a result of various factors, including market demand, regulatory developments, and investor sentiment. It's important for investors to stay informed and understand the risks associated with investing in cryptocurrencies.
